The foundations

Learn, analyse, go again.

Hervé has been involved in motorsport from a young age. Karting taught him racing lines, consistency, speed management and how to look after the machinery.

Amateur races then gave him experience in real competition conditions. In 2025, discovering Fun Cup marked his move into endurance racing and teamwork.
